Output d4aec27f2e948bfab81ea7272cf7bdba6832eac8c1cd562d8a22cc0c671b20aa:0

value
552955970
script pubkey
OP_0 OP_PUSHBYTES_20 1762609755ff2a4af21de6a3ad6d2a7675a8db61
address
bc1qza3xp964lu4y4usau6366mf2we663kmpl2ps3c
transaction
d4aec27f2e948bfab81ea7272cf7bdba6832eac8c1cd562d8a22cc0c671b20aa
confirmations
137519
spent
true